Marquette-lez-Lille (Dutch: Market(t)e) is a commune in the Nord department in northern France.

It is part of the Urban Community of Lille Métropole.

Heraldry

The arms of Marquette-lez-Lille are blazoned :
Azure, the name 'Marquette' bendwise between 2 bendlets argent.
